Masts reveal ‘Don’t Go Off’ a new track from their album ‘Adversaries’

 

FFO: Polar Bear Club, The Get Up Kids, Braid & Hot Water Music

Cardiff punks, MASTS are continuing to build on the excitement surrounding the release of their debut album ‘Adversaries’.

‘Adversaries’ is due for release Friday 19th February on Jealous Lovers Club records and today, the band has unveiled ‘Don’t Go Off‘, a second track from their album.

Following on from ‘Monaghan’ their riotous first single which premiered via Punknews in December, ‘Don’t Go Off’ proudly showcases a different side to the genre-blending post punk band. With a steadier, brooding track that is more patient in it’s approach but hits just as hard.

In the lead up to their album launch, which takes place at the famous Clwb Ifor Bach on 19th February, Masts have announced a run of shows with melodic punk band Deadlines with shows at Nottingham’s JT Soar and The Quadrant in Brighton.

TOUR DATES

16/02/16 – JT Soar, Nottingham (with Deadlines)
17/02/16 – The Quadrant, Brighton (with Deadlines)
19/02/16 – Clwb Ifor Bach, Cardiff – Album Release Show (with Deadlines & Esuna)
